Kittitas County is located in the state of Washington, with a total population of 47935. The land area spans approximately 5949.976954 square miles, contributing to its total area of 6042.412959 square miles.

Kittitas County, Washington Population Demographics

As of the last census, Kittitas County has a total population of 47935, out of which 24205 are Male while 23730 are female.

You can check the total population for every year in the below table:

Year Population
2010 40990
2011 41554
2012 41624
2013 41828
2014 42596
2015 43095
2016 44922
2017 46176
2018 47358
2019 47935
